  • Patent number: 8405045
    Abstract: A particle beam device includes a particle beam generator, an objective lens, and first and second deflection systems for deflecting the particle beam in an object plane defined by the objective lens. In a first operating mode, the first deflection system generates a first deflection field and the second deflection system generates a second deflection field. In a second operating mode, the first deflection system generates a third deflection field and the second deflection system generates a fourth deflection field.

  • Publication number: 20120104250
    Abstract: A method of operating a charged-particle microscope, the method comprising: recording a first image of a first region of an object in a first setting; recording a second image of a second region of the object using the charged-particle microscope in a second setting; reading a third image of a third region using the charged-particle microscope, wherein the first and second regions are contained at least partially within the third region; displaying a representation of the first image at least partly within the displayed third image, wherein the representation of the first image includes a first indicator which is indicative of the first setting; displaying a representation of the second image at least partly within the displayed third image, wherein the representation of the second image includes a second indicator which is indicative of the second setting, and wherein the displayed second indicator is different from the displayed first indicator.
